#3b564f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3b564f is composed of 23.1% red, 33.7%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 8.1% yellow and 66.3% black. It has a hue angle of 164.4 degrees, a saturation of 18.6% and a lightness of 28.4%. #3b564f color hex could be obtained by blending #76ac9e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#3b564f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030504 is the darkest color, while #f8fafa is the lightest one.

Tones of #3b564f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#464b4a is the less saturated color, while #038e6a is the most saturated one.
